]> xenbits.xensource.com Git - unikraft/libs/musl.git/commitdiff
Call configure after patching
authorGaulthier Gain <gaulthier.gain@uliege.be>
Wed, 29 Jan 2020 21:18:25 +0000 (22:18 +0100)
committerSimon Kuenzer <simon.kuenzer@neclab.eu>
Thu, 30 Jan 2020 20:55:56 +0000 (21:55 +0100)
Update Makefile.uk to run the configure script after patching.

Signed-off-by: Gaulthier Gain <gaulthier.gain@uliege.be>
Reviewed-by: Simon Kuenzer <simon.kuenzer@neclab.eu>
Makefile.uk

index 393799374e7bfd155595cce11b13ceabebb900da..8838db0c1e4dfaeb80436ae3074c4c959ef60d77 100644 (file)
@@ -68,9 +68,11 @@ CXXINCLUDES-y  += $(LIBMUSL_GLOBAL_INCLUDES-y)
 # Musl-specific Targets
 ################################################################################
 # generate alltypes.h through musl sed script                        
-$(LIBMUSL)/arch/$(ARCH)/bits/alltypes.h:
-                             $(call verbose_cmd,CONFIGURE,libmusl: $@,\
-                             sed -f $(LIBMUSL)/tools/mkalltypes.sed $(LIBMUSL)/arch/$(ARCH)/bits/alltypes.h.in $(LIBMUSL)/include/alltypes.h.in > $@ && \
+$(LIBMUSL)/arch/$(ARCH)/bits/alltypes.h: $(LIBMUSL_BUILD)/.patched
+                             $(call verbose_cmd,CONFIGURE,libmusl: $(notdir $@),\
+                             sed -f $(LIBMUSL)/tools/mkalltypes.sed \
+                             $(LIBMUSL)/arch/$(ARCH)/bits/alltypes.h.in \
+                             $(LIBMUSL)/include/alltypes.h.in > $@ && \
                              $(TOUCH) $@)
 
 # generate syscall.h